vmware安装hadoop
时间: 2024-06-07 20:03:56 浏览: 175
VMware可以用来创建一个隔离的环境来安装和配置Hadoop。以下是使用VMware安装Hadoop的一般步骤:
1. **准备环境**:
- **下载VMware Workstation或Player**: 选择适合您的操作系统版本的虚拟机软件。
- **创建新的虚拟机(VM)**: 选择Linux作为主机操作系统,因为Hadoop主要在Linux上运行。
2. **安装Linux虚拟机**:
- 从Linux发行版官方网站下载ISO镜像文件(如Ubuntu Server、CentOS等)。
- 在VMware中,导入ISO镜像并配置新虚拟机的内存、CPU和硬盘大小。
3. **设置网络**:
- 通常选择桥接模式,让虚拟机直接连接到主机的网络,以便Hadoop节点之间通信。
4. **安装Linux**:
- 在虚拟机中安装Linux,按照引导过程完成安装。
5. **安装Hadoop**:
- 开机登录后,添加Hadoop仓库(如果不在源列表中):
```
sudo apt-get install apt-transport-https
curl -o /etc/apt/trusted.gpg.d/hadoop.gpg https://www.apache.org/dist/hadoop/common/GPG-KEY-HADOOP
echo "deb [signed-by=/etc/apt/trusted.gpg.d/hadoop.gpg] http://archive.apache.org/dist/hadoop/debian $(lsb_release -cs) main" | sudo tee /etc/apt/sources.list.d/hadoop.list
```
- 更新包列表并安装Hadoop:
```
sudo apt-get update
sudo apt-get install hadoop-hdfs hadoop-yarn hadoop-client
```
6. **配置Hadoop**:
- 需要编辑`core-site.xml`, `hdfs-site.xml`, `yarn-site.xml`等配置文件,根据实际需求调整。
- 完成HDFS和YARN的启动:
```
sudo service hadoop-hdfs start
sudo service yarn start
```
7. **验证安装**:
- 可以通过命令行工具如`hadoop fs -ls`检查HDFS,`jps`查看YARN进程是否正常运行。
8. **安全性考虑**:
- 如果在生产环境中使用,还需要配置 Kerberos、SSL等相关安全措施。
**相关问题**:
1. 使用VMware的优势是什么?
2. Hadoop的其他组件有哪些?
3. 如何配置Hadoop的安全模式?
阅读全文